新闻公告

解析云VPS主机CPU使用率100%的原因及应对策略

VPS主机是一种高效的托管解决方案,但有时候会出现CPU使用率达到100%的情况。下面将介绍三种常见的原因,并提供相应的解决策略。


1. 硬件配置太低


如果你的云VPS主机硬件配置较低,无法满足网站的资源需求,就容易导致CPU使用率飙升至100%。这时候,你可以考虑升级硬件配置,增加CPU核心数、内存容量等,以提高系统性能和资源处理能力。另外,也可以考虑优化网站程序、缓存设置等,减少对CPU的负载。


2. 网络攻击


恶意网络攻击是导致云VPS主机CPU使用率飙升的常见原因之一。攻击者通过发送大量请求或利用漏洞耗尽服务器资源,使CPU负载达到极限。为了应对这种情况,你可以采取以下措施:


- 安装防火墙和入侵检测系统,实施网络安全防护。

- 及时更新系统和应用程序的补丁,以修复已知漏洞。

- 使用安全认证机制,限制非法访问和恶意行为。

- 监控服务器日志,及时发现异常活动并采取相应措施。


3. 网站程序兼容性和优化


随着网站程序的发展和CMS后台的成熟,一些版本可能存在兼容性问题或资源占用过高的情况,导致CPU使用率达到100%。为了解决这个问题,可以采取以下步骤:


- 选择稳定的版本:选择经过测试和验证的稳定版本,避免使用开发者版本或存在明显问题的版本。

- 控制插件和功能:合理选择需要使用的插件和功能,避免过多的不必要的负载。

- 定期清理缓存:定期清理网站缓存,以释放资源并提高网站的响应速度。

- 进行性能优化:优化网站程序代码、数据库查询语句等,减少资源消耗,提高运行效率。


总结:


云VPS主机的CPU使用率达到100%可能是由于硬件配置不足、网络攻击或网站程序兼容性和优化问题所致。在面对这些问题时,可以通过升级硬件配置、加强网络安全防护、选择稳定版本、控制插件和功能、定期清理缓存以及进行性能优化等措施来解决。保持云VPS主机的稳定性和高性能对于网站的正常运行至关重要,因此及时采取适当的应对策略是非常重要的。


QQ在线咨询
请加好友再发消息
751200202
企业微信
扫码微信咨询